高效备份:性能可靠的MySQL大数据方案

资源类型:wx-1.com 2025-07-18 07:48

性能可靠mysql大数据备份简介:



性能可靠:构建MySQL大数据备份的坚实防线 在当今数字化时代,数据已成为企业最宝贵的资产之一

    对于依赖MySQL数据库存储海量数据的组织而言,确保数据的完整性、可用性和安全性至关重要

    尤其是在大数据环境下,数据的规模、复杂度和增长速度对备份策略提出了更高要求

    因此,构建一个性能可靠的MySQL大数据备份系统,不仅是数据保护的基本需求,更是业务连续性和灾难恢复计划的核心组成部分

    本文将深入探讨如何实施一个高效、可靠的MySQL大数据备份方案,以应对日益严峻的数据管理挑战

     一、理解MySQL大数据备份的重要性 MySQL作为开源关系型数据库管理系统,凭借其高性能、灵活性和广泛的社区支持,在众多行业中得到了广泛应用

    然而,随着数据量的激增,传统的备份方法可能面临效率低下、恢复时间长、资源消耗大等问题

    大数据备份不仅要能够快速捕捉数据变化,减少备份窗口,还要能在关键时刻迅速恢复数据,保证业务不中断

    此外,面对勒索软件攻击、硬件故障等潜在威胁,一个可靠的备份方案能够有效防止数据丢失,保障企业信息安全

     二、性能可靠的MySQL大数据备份关键要素 1.备份策略的选择:根据数据类型、业务需求和资源状况,选择合适的备份策略是基础

    全量备份虽能确保数据完整性,但耗时长、占用空间大;增量备份和差异备份则能显著提高备份效率,减少存储需求

    结合使用这些策略,如定期进行全量备份,日常采用增量或差异备份,可以平衡备份效率与恢复能力

     2.备份工具与技术:选择高效、稳定的备份工具是实现可靠备份的关键

    MySQL自带的`mysqldump`工具适用于小规模数据备份,但对于大数据场景,推荐使用如Percona XtraBackup、MySQL Enterprise Backup等专业工具,它们支持热备份(无需停止数据库服务),大大提高了备份的灵活性和可用性

    同时,考虑采用分布式存储和并行处理技术,进一步提升备份速度

     3.压缩与加密:大数据备份往往伴随着巨大的存储需求,使用压缩技术可以有效减少备份文件的大小,节省存储空间,并加快数据传输速度

    此外,加密备份数据是保护敏感信息、防止未经授权访问的必要措施

    采用强加密算法,确保备份数据在传输和存储过程中的安全性

     4.自动化与监控:手动执行备份任务不仅效率低下,还容易出错

    通过脚本化、定时任务或集成到运维管理系统(如Ansible、Puppet)中,实现备份过程的自动化,可以大大提高备份的及时性和准确性

    同时,建立全面的监控体系,实时跟踪备份作业的状态、进度和成功率,及时发现并解决潜在问题

     5.测试与验证:备份的最终目的是能够在需要时快速恢复数据

    因此,定期对备份数据进行恢复测试至关重要

    这不仅能验证备份的有效性和完整性,还能检验恢复流程的效率,确保在真实灾难发生时,能够迅速恢复业务运行

     三、实施步骤与最佳实践 1.评估现有环境:首先,全面评估MySQL数据库的规模、数据类型、增长速率以及现有硬件和软件资源

    这有助于制定合适的备份策略和选择合适的工具

     2.制定备份计划:基于评估结果,设计备份策略,包括备份频率、保留周期、存储位置等

    确保计划符合业务连续性和合规性要求

     3.配置备份工具:根据所选工具,进行必要的配置,如设置备份路径、压缩级别、加密参数等

    确保工具与MySQL数据库版本兼容,且能充分利用现有资源

     4.实施自动化:利用脚本或管理工具设置自动化备份任务,确保备份按计划执行,减少人为干预

     5.建立监控与报警机制:集成监控工具,设置备份成功/失败报警,及时响应异常情况

     6.定期演练恢复:至少每年进行一次全面的数据恢复演练,验证备份的有效性和恢复流程的有效性

     7.持续优化:根据备份执行情况和业务发展,不断调整备份策略,引入新技术,提高备份效率和恢复速度

     四、结语 在大数据时代,构建一个性能可靠的MySQL大数据备份系统,是企业保障数据安全、维持业务连续性的基石

    通过合理选择备份策略、采用高效工具、实施自动化与监控、加强数据保护与测试验证,可以有效提升备份的效率和可靠性

    同时,保持对新技术和最佳实践的关注,持续优化备份流程,将为企业应对未来数据挑战奠定坚实的基础

    记住,备份不是一次性任务,而是需要持续关注和投入的长期战略,它直接关系到企业的生存和发展

    在这个数据为王的时代,让我们携手构建更加坚固的数据保护防线,共创数字化未来

    

阅读全文
上一篇:MySQL数据库压缩与打开方法指南

最新收录:

  • MySQL查询技巧:如何高效SELECT多个值
  • CentOS自动备份MySQL数据库技巧
  • MySQL中高效排名函数应用指南
  • 揭秘开源MySQL线程池的高效奥秘
  • MySQL为何没有自动备份功能探秘
  • MySQL反向筛选:高效排除无用数据技巧
  • 命令行掌控:高效操作MySQL数据库
  • MySQL数据读取实战:高效代码示例解析
  • MySQL连接池深度解析指南
  • 揭秘高性能MySQL分析器:速度与精准并存
  • MySQL技巧揭秘:掌握非条件查询的高效应用
  • 高效管理MySQL:探索顶级可视化维护工具
  • 首页 | 性能可靠mysql大数据备份:高效备份:性能可靠的MySQL大数据方案